当前位置:首页>维修大全>综合>

为什么带头结点的循环单链表为空的条件(带头结点的双循环链表为空的条件)

为什么带头结点的循环单链表为空的条件(带头结点的双循环链表为空的条件)

更新时间:2024-01-18 14:47:15

为什么带头结点的循环单链表为空的条件

带头结点的循环单链表为空的条件是头结点的指针域指向自身,即头结点的next指针指向头结点本身。

这是因为带头结点的循环单链表在创建时,头结点的next指针就指向自身,表示链表为空。当链表中没有任何元素时,头结点的指针域指向自身,表示链表为空。因此,判断带头结点的循环单链表是否为空,只需要判断头结点的next指针是否指向自身即可。

更多栏目